How many cubic meters of helium are required to lift a balloon with a 400 -kg payload to a height of 8000 $\mathrm{m}$ ? (Take $\rho_{\mathrm{Hc}}=0.180 \mathrm{kg} / \mathrm{m}^{3} . )$ Assume the balloon maintains a constant volume and the density of air decreases with the altitude $z$ according to the expression $\rho_{\text { air }}=\rho_{0} e^{-z / 8} 000$ where $z$ is in meters and $\rho_{0}=1.25 \mathrm{kg} / \mathrm{m}^{3}$ is the density of nair at sea level.
